Welcome to Tech Rando, a data science blog with complete step-by-step Python tutorials.

Tech Rando began in 2019, with the intent of sharing open source data science solutions with a wide audience across the internet. The ultimate goal of Tech Rando is to make data science and statistics topics accessible, easy to understand, and easy to implement.

About Kirsten Perry, Tech Rando Contributor

I am a data scientist in the renewable energy sector, working on machine learning and artificial intelligence applications in the solar space at the National Renewable Energy Laboratory (NREL) in Golden, CO. Before going into renewables, I worked in the energy industry as an engineer/data scientist at BP America. I have significant experience in database architecture, data engineering, and data visualization. I hold joint undergraduate degrees in mathematics and mechanical engineering from the University of Oklahoma, and a master’s degree in computer science with an emphasis in machine learning from Georgia Institute of Technology.

All thoughts presented in this blog are my own.
